I’m an educator at heart, a lifelong learner, and someone who believes wisdom grows when intellect and creativity are both given room to lead.

​

For more than thirty years, my work has centered on helping people make informed, thoughtful decisions about their lives. My professional path has been intentionally expansive. I have served as a pharmacist, mediator, attorney, adjunct professor, and licensed insurance professional. Across every role, one thread has remained constant: a deep commitment to education, empowerment, and guiding others toward choices they can feel confident living with.

 

While my analytical side shaped my career, my creative side has always shaped my spirit. I am drawn to storytelling, writing fiction, and composing songs. Creativity keeps me curious and reminds me that life is meant to be experienced, not simply managed.

 

These days, I am especially excited to step into a new and joyful role, becoming Nana. It feels less like a milestone and more like an expansion. It is a tender reminder of legacy, love, and the generations we influence by how we choose to live.

 

More than anything, I believe life should be lived with intention, spaciousness, and courage, and that wisdom is one of the greatest gifts we can offer one another.

My Work and Why I Do It

Over the years, I have observed how easily capable women can build successful lives that no longer feel aligned with who they truly are. Achievement, responsibility, and expectation have a quiet way of pulling us away from our original design.

This realization shaped the philosophy that now guides my work:

 

The goal is not to become someone new.
It is to return to who you were created to be.

​

Through my SOFT Life Framework™ — Secure Your Future, Own Your Time, Flow in Purpose, and Trust God’s Timing — I help accomplished women realign their wealth, health, time, and purpose so the lives they are building genuinely support them.

​

As a financial educator, I am particularly passionate about helping women step off the emotional rollercoaster of the market and create lasting stability. True security extends beyond money. It includes well-being, autonomy, and the capacity to enjoy the life you have worked so hard to build.

 

I am also an author, and I write books designed to spark reflection and deepen awareness. My guiding motto is simple:

I write books to make you think about what you think about.

​

Whether I am speaking, teaching, or writing, I hope that you feel encouraged to accept that you can live well, build what lasts, and move forward in alignment with who you were always meant to be.
